Solution of Fuzzy Schrödinger Equation in Positron-Hydrogen Scattering Using Ant Colony Programming

並列摘要


In this paper, solution of Takagi-Sugeno (T-S) fuzzy Schrödinger equation with linear potential in Positron-Hydrogen scattering is obtained using ant colony programming (ACP). The ACP solution is equivalent or very close to the exact solution of the problem. Accuracy of the solution computed by ACP approach to the problem is qualitatively better. The solution of this novel method is compared with the traditional Runge Kutta (RK) method and Numerov's method. An illustrative numerical example is presented for the proposed method.
